<P>Now, a new documentary, <A
href="https://www.zed.fr/en/catalog/rivers-above-the-canopy" rel=external
target=_blank><EM>Rivers Above the Canopy</EM></A>, by French filmmaker Pascal
Cuissot, features Antonio Nobre and his investigations into the Amazon’s
importance to the global climate. The film has been shown in France, Germany and
Brazil.</P>
<P>Also featured is physicist Anastassia Makarieva of the Petersburg Nuclear
Physics Institute in Russia, who, with the late Victor Gorshkov, first came up
with the concept of the biotic pump, an active function of forests.
Increasingly, Nobre’s work on the Amazon is informed by this theory. For
example, in a 2014 report, “The Future Climate of Amazonia,” a tour-de-force of
explanatory science, Nobre describes how this “green ocean” not only creates its
own rain but moves moisture across the continent via aerial rivers. Lately, he
has collaborated on scientific papers with Makarieva and other biotic pump
researchers.</P>
